KOREA.
OPPOSITION TO JAPANESE,
(Australian & N.Z. Cable Association.)
TOKIC* April 3,
Anti-Japanese risings in. Korea ai£ growing. L Demonstrators have had many conflicts with the military, and th© hospitals are filled with casualties. Strikes in Government offices and on the tramways and railways have been resumed.
Shopkeepers’ passive resistance con tinues.
